Teaching Experience:
I have been teaching in primary and secondary schools in the UK for the past 6 years, with 2 years experience teaching in an international school in Istanbul, Turkey. I have been a class teacher in various year groups in primary and intermediate level.
I have been an acting deputy head in an inner city London school for a year as well as having various management roles in schools - these have included key stage coordinator, assessment/English/humanities coordinator as well as head of games. I have mentored newly qualified teachers and assessed their teaching so to help them improve in their own professional development.
